MINNESOTA REPORTS 7 DEATHS, 698 NEW CASES OF COVID-19 INCLUDING 3 IN POLK COUNTY

The Minnesota Department of Health is reporting 698 new cases of COVID-19 and seven deaths. There were 13,810 tests completed for a positive rate of 5.1 percent. MINNESOTA REPORTS 17 DEATHS, 567 NEW CASES OF COVID-19 INCLUDING 7 IN POLK COUNTY

The Minnesota Department of Health is reporting 17 additional COVID-19 related deaths, all but one of which was 70 years of age or older.  They are also reporting 567 new positive cases from 34,879 completed tests for a 1.6 percent positive rate. MINNESOTA ADDS 754 NEW COVID CASES AND SEVEN DEATHS, POSITIVE TEST RATE OF 5%

The Minnesota Department of Health released the latest COVID-19 numbers and the state had 754 new positive cases with seven deaths.  There were 16,689 tests with a positive rate of 5 percent.   Polk County reported one new case, and Red Lake County had two new cases.  All the numbers are below.   Updated August 16, 2020

MINNESOTA REPORTS 8 DEATHS, 738 NEW CASES OF COVID-19 INCLUDING 5 IN POLK COUNTY

The Minnesota Department of Health is reporting 738 new cases of COVID-19 from 16,617 completed tests for a 4.4 percent positive rate and eight deaths. MINNESOTA REPORTS 7 DEATH, 697 NEW CASES OF COVID-19

The Minnesota Department of Health reported 697 new cases of COVID-19 on Thursday, none in Polk County.  There were 14,744 completed tests, for a 4.7 percent positive rate.  Seven additional deaths were also reported.
